 /*
  * Create the subscription...
  */

  if (strstr(uri, "/jobs/"))
  {
    request = ippNewRequest(IPP_CREATE_JOB_SUBSCRIPTION);
    ippAddString(request, IPP_TAG_OPERATION, IPP_TAG_URI, "job-uri", NULL, uri);
  }
  else
  {
    request = ippNewRequest(IPP_CREATE_PRINTER_SUBSCRIPTION);
    ippAddString(request, IPP_TAG_OPERATION, IPP_TAG_URI, "printer-uri", NULL,
                 uri);
  }

  ippAddString(request, IPP_TAG_OPERATION, IPP_TAG_NAME, "requesting-user-name",
               NULL, cupsUser());

  ippAddStrings(request, IPP_TAG_SUBSCRIPTION, IPP_TAG_KEYWORD, "notify-events",
                num_events, NULL, events);
  ippAddString(request, IPP_TAG_SUBSCRIPTION, IPP_TAG_KEYWORD,
               "notify-pull-method", NULL, "ippget");

  response = cupsDoRequest(http, request, uri);
  if (cupsLastError() >= IPP_BAD_REQUEST)
  {
    fprintf(stderr, "Create-%s-Subscription: %s\n",
            strstr(uri, "/jobs") ? "Job" : "Printer", cupsLastErrorString());
    ippDelete(response);
    httpClose(http);
    return (1);
  }

  if ((attr = ippFindAttribute(response, "notify-subscription-id",
                               IPP_TAG_INTEGER)) == NULL)
  {
    fputs("ERROR: No notify-subscription-id in response!\n", stderr);
    ippDelete(response);
    httpClose(http);
    return (1);
  }

  subscription_id = attr->values[0].integer;

  printf("Create-%s-Subscription: notify-subscription-id=%d\n",
         strstr(uri, "/jobs/") ? "Job" : "Printer", subscription_id);

  ippDelete(response);

 /*
  * Monitor for events...
  */

  sequence_number = 0;

  while (!terminate)
  {
   /*
    * Get the current events...
    */

    printf("\nGet-Notifications(%d,%d):", subscription_id, sequence_number);
    fflush(stdout);

    request = ippNewRequest(IPP_GET_NOTIFICATIONS);

    if (strstr(uri, "/jobs/"))
      ippAddString(request, IPP_TAG_OPERATION, IPP_TAG_URI, "job-uri", NULL, uri);
    else
      ippAddString(request, IPP_TAG_OPERATION, IPP_TAG_URI, "printer-uri", NULL,
                   uri);

    ippAddString(request, IPP_TAG_OPERATION, IPP_TAG_NAME,
                 "requesting-user-name", NULL, cupsUser());

    ippAddInteger(request, IPP_TAG_OPERATION, IPP_TAG_INTEGER,
                  "notify-subscription-ids", subscription_id);
    if (sequence_number)
      ippAddInteger(request, IPP_TAG_OPERATION, IPP_TAG_INTEGER,
                    "notify-sequence-numbers", sequence_number + 1);

    response = cupsDoRequest(http, request, uri);

    printf(" %s\n", ippErrorString(cupsLastError()));

    if (cupsLastError() >= IPP_BAD_REQUEST)
      fprintf(stderr, "Get-Notifications: %s\n", cupsLastErrorString());
    else if (response)
    {
      print_attributes(response, 0);

      for (attr = ippFindAttribute(response, "notify-sequence-number",
                                   IPP_TAG_INTEGER);
           attr;
	   attr = ippFindNextAttribute(response, "notify-sequence-number",
	                               IPP_TAG_INTEGER))
        if (attr->values[0].integer > sequence_number)
	  sequence_number = attr->values[0].integer;
    }

    if ((attr = ippFindAttribute(response, "notify-get-interval",
                                 IPP_TAG_INTEGER)) != NULL &&
        attr->values[0].integer > 0)
      interval = attr->values[0].integer;
    else
      interval = 5;

    ippDelete(response);
    sleep(interval);
  }
